We are looking for a Software Engineer to drive process improvement around Builds, Automation and Tools in the Infrastructure team. This person will create sustainable practices and have the opportunity to grow in other areas of the Engineering team. Our headquarters are located in San Mateo, CA but this role can be fully remote.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and support platform build tools, automation and test infrastructure
  • Own and troubleshoot the release tools and fix operational problems as they arise
  • Develop and streamline technology that improves productivity for all of engineering
  • Participate in code reviews
  • Make product changes when needed for operational improvements

Requirements

  • 2 years of experience as a Software Engineer
  • Experience developing in C++
  • Experience in one or more scripting languages, such as: BASH, Perl, Python, Powershell
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ills with str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Familiarity with source control systems
  • BS degree in Computer Science or a related field or 2+ years industry experience as the degree equivalent

Pluses

  • Professional experience with Jenkins
  • Experience with Cloud Services (Azure, AWS, or gCloud)
  • Experience with Unreal 4 or Unreal 5
  • Familiarity with Windows development and administration
